Description
Stand-alone scaffolder of pre-assembled contigs using paired-read data.
For example, 454 contigs can be joined into long scaffolds containing many contigs with information from paired end Illumina sequence data.
Main features are: a short runtime, multiple library input of paired-end and/or mate pair datasets and possible contig extension with unmapped sequence reads.
